    We requested a plated meal that had that "fall" feel to it so Ginny suggested Beef Bourgeon, Parmesan Encrusted Whitefish, Roasted Assorted Red Skin Potatoes with lemon dill and Roasted Root Vegetables. The plates had hearty portions and each item could not have tasted better!! Prior to the entrees' she served Lake Michigan Salad (with gorgonzola on the side) and a fantastic pumpkin squash soup served in small, hollowed out pumpkins. People raved about the dressing on the salad and absolutely loved the soup. Not only did the soup taste fantastic, but the aroma of the soup definitely added to the "warm, cozy feeling of fall". Ginny provided ample wait staff who prior to the reception set up each table with the necessary flatware and glassware and then at the time dinner was served, worked non-stop to serve the 200 people in attendance being very aware to clear the dishes as people completed a particular course.

    We received two answers when asking our guests about the food at our wedding--it was the "absolutely amazing" OR "it was good but mine was cold". It took around an hour & a half to get everyone served (200 people). They were clearing some table's plates before some were even initially served. Even though on the menu, only a chicken & steak combo plated meal was offered. We chose to do a single entree plated dinner, choice of steak, chicken or fish to save on the cost. I had spoken to one of the owners, Ginny during our original tasting about this option and she seemed as though it was no problem at all and they were happy to do that for us instead of their normal duo entree. This was especially frustrating because I had spoken to the owner a few weeks prior to the wedding and expressed concerns about how I wanted all tables served at the same time or within a reasonable time of one another. She ensured me everyone was served very quickly and that a long serving time would absolutely not happen using her company. We even opted for additional servers to ensure just that. Obviously didn't pay off.
    I will give compliments to their flexibility-she worked with us on everything, especially price. Prices were very reasonable for the excellent quality of food and presentation on the adult meals. She agreed to everything we requested right away, but seemed a year later when it came time to deliver, she wasn't prepared to honor it or some of the things she was going to "throw in" were forgotten about. I would highly suggest getting everything in writing-even the tiniest of details. Organization is not their strong suit and as a bride you have to enough to worry about.     This caterer has the ability to make great tasting food, however, lacks customer service and good business sense. Let's start with the fact that communicating with her is nearly impossible. We didn't even have a finalized menu until a week before the wedding because she wouldn't return emails or calls. The "star" bartender she promised was a fiasco. She hired some confused chick to basically disappoint our guests. One of our guests actually had to teach her how to make a Mojito (this was our signature drink, which we had arranged months prior with Ginny). Not to mention we had asked her to make simple syrup for us only to find out from other guests that she was simply using the sugar packets from the coffee station and not even bothering to muddle the mint. After the wedding when I brought this up to Ginny, she justified it by saying we didn't get charged for the simple syrup anyway. Not only did we pay $25 an hour for this incompetent bartender, she also had the audacity to have a tip box out during our event, which we DID NOT approve. It was tacky and completely out of place. Did I mention she also thought it was a good idea to rip open every single wine seal? We actually had hired a company that would buy back any unused bottle of alcohol...thanks to her we ended up having to keep a lot of wine. Overall I would say the food was good but not worth the disappointment or the headache...sorry.
